中文域名转码查询,是指将中文域名转换为对应的编码格式,以便在网络中进行传输和识别,随着互联网的发展,越来越多的企业和个人开始使用中文域名,但由于历史原因和技术限制,中文域名在网络中的处理方式与英文域名有所不同,了解中文域名转码查询的方法和原理,对于网站运营者和开发者来说具有重要意义。
我们需要了解什么是中文域名,中文域名是指使用中文字符表示的域名,如“百度.com”就是一个典型的中文域名,与英文域名相比,中文域名更符合中国人的语言习惯,便于记忆和传播,由于计算机系统最初是按照英文字母设计的,因此在处理中文域名时需要进行转码。
中文域名转码查询的过程可以分为以下几个步骤:
1. 域名解析:当用户输入一个中文域名时,浏览器会首先向DNS服务器发送一个查询请求,询问该域名对应的IP地址,这个过程称为域名解析。
2. 转码处理:DNS服务器收到查询请求后,会根据预先设定的规则对中文域名进行转码处理,转码的目的是将中文域名转换为计算机系统可以识别的编码格式,如UTF-8、GBK等。
3. 查询结果:经过转码处理后,DNS服务器会返回一个包含IP地址的查询结果,浏览器收到查询结果后,会根据IP地址访问目标网站。
4. 显示网页:浏览器根据IP地址加载目标网站的网页内容,并将其显示给用户。
需要注意的是,由于不同的浏览器和操作系统对中文域名的处理方式可能有所不同,因此在进行中文域名转码查询时,需要考虑到兼容性问题,为了保证网站的安全和稳定运行,建议使用权威的DNS服务商提供的服务。
接下来,我们来看一个实际的中文域名转码查询的例子,假设我们要查询“百度.com”这个中文域名的IP地址,可以按照以下步骤操作:
1. 打开浏览器,输入“百度.com”,然后按回车键。
2. 观察浏览器地址栏的变化,如果浏览器能够正确识别并处理中文域名,地址栏中会显示“www.baidu.com”。
3. 按下F12键,打开浏览器的开发者工具,在开发者工具的“Network”选项卡中,可以看到一个名为“dns”的请求记录,点击该记录,可以查看详细的查询信息。
4. 在查询信息中,可以找到“name”字段,其值为“www.baidu.com”,这表明浏览器已经对中文域名进行了转码处理。
5. 继续向下查找,可以找到“address”字段,其值为“14.215.177.38”,这就是“百度.com”这个中文域名对应的IP地址。
通过以上步骤,我们可以了解到中文域名转码查询的基本过程和方法,在实际工作中,可以根据需要选择合适的工具和服务进行操作。
我们来回答一些与本文相关的问题:
1. 为什么需要对中文域名进行转码处理?
答:由于计算机系统最初是按照英文字母设计的,因此在处理中文域名时需要进行转码,转码的目的是将中文域名转换为计算机系统可以识别的编码格式,如UTF-8、GBK等。
2. 如何进行中文域名转码查询?
答:可以通过浏览器输入中文域名并访问目标网站,或者使用开发者工具查看查询信息,在查询信息中,可以找到对应的IP地址。
3. 不同的浏览器和操作系统对中文域名的处理方式是否相同?
答:不同浏览器和操作系统对中文域名的处理方式可能有所不同,为了确保兼容性,建议使用权威的DNS服务商提供的服务。
4. 如何保证网站的安全和稳定运行?
答:可以使用权威的DNS服务商提供的服务,定期检查和更新DNS记录,以及配置合理的防火墙和安全策略,还需要关注网络安全的最新动态和技术发展,及时采取相应的防护措施。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/82109.html